Year-over-Year Comparison
| Year | Population | Violent Crime | Violent Rate | Murders | Property Crime | Property Rate |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 1,357 | 3 | 221.1 | 0 | 11 | 810.6 |
| 2023 | 1,374 | 5 | 363.9 | 0 | 5 | 363.9 |
| 2022 | 1,379 | 2 | 145.0 | 0 | 7 | 507.6 |
| 2021 | 1,209 | 1 | 82.7 | 0 | 4 | 330.9 |
| 2020 | 1,211 | 2 | 165.2 | 0 | 6 | 495.5 |
